X.8770 X.8305 X.8310 I understand that our best chassis will be the one with the gearbox attached to the engine, made as small, simple and light as possible. No doubt four speeds will be needed by Sales and servo drive. This may require a fabric coupling or rubber damper drive behind the gearbox, so that we should arrange for this in the first instance. We already have something instructed, but it will now require reviewing. R. {Sir Henry Royce} | ||
